Target Audience

This activity is intended for neurologists and other medical professionals with a specific interest in the management of Parkinson's Disease.

Learning Objectives:

At the conclusion of this continuing medical education activity, participants should be able to:

  • Identify the motor complications associated with Parkinson's Disease and their causes
  • Explain the pharmacologic treatment options available for managing motor complications
  • Discuss the implications of recent studies evaluating dosing manipulations of Levodopa
